Savannah, GA (February 1, 2024) – The Savannah Christian Preparatory School (SCPS) football program announced the addition of Dominique Allen as their new Offensive Coordinator. Dominique Allen brings a wealth of experience and passion to the coaching staff.
Athletic Director Greg Phillips stated, "Dominique represents the character and personality with which we desire to surround our student-athletes to help them achieve their goals and aspirations. He understands what is needed for a high school student-athlete to be successful at a high level on and off the field."
Allen, a Richmond Hill native and a former Richmond Hill High School standout
football player, brings a successful playing career to the table. After graduating, Dominique quarterbacked The Citadel, securing the starting position in his sophomore year and leading the team for three seasons. His coaching journey saw him in various roles at The Citadel, including Assistant Quarterbacks Coach, A-Backs Coach, and Assistant Offensive Line Coach from 2020 to 2023.
Head Coach Baker Woodward stated, "Dominique has a thorough knowledge of offensive football from his days playing Quarterback at Citadel and coaching various positions the last few years. He is ahead of his time when it comes to offensive football. He will build on our previous success but put his spin on the offense. He relates well to our players and coaches, and we look forward to welcoming his family to SCPS."
Beyond his coaching duties, Allen will join the SCPS upper school academic staff. Allen stated, "I am extremely fortunate and blessed to join the SCPS community and coaching staff. It's always been a dream of mine to be an offensive coordinator at a premier program like SCPS. I look forward to working with the athletes and aiding them in any way possible to turn their dreams into realities like so many coaches did for me."
